da gbg bet: For the second successive season, the Wearsiders will welcome Mansfield Town to the Stadium of Light in the first round, and they will be seeking to avenge last year’s shock 0-1 defeat to the Stags when the teams face off on the first weekend of November.
Mansfield were a lowly 22nd in League Two at the time and coincidentally they are in the same position in the current standings, with Lee Johnson’s Sunderland hoping that their place near the top of League One will be reflected when Nigel Clough brings his team to Wearside.
The Black Cats have exited at the second round or earlier in each of the last three seasons since dropping into League One, which brought with it the necessity to enter in the first round, two steps earlier than when they were in the Premier League and Championship.
